(Lawrenceburg, Ind.) – Don't forget to spring forward this weekend.

Daylight Saving Time begins Sunday, March 14 at 2:00 a.m. and runs through Sunday, November 7.

Everyone should set their clocks forward by one hour on Sunday.

Daylight Saving decreases the amount of sunlight in the morning but allows more light in the evening.

Along with setting clocks, fire chiefs recommend homeowners to change their smoke alarm batteries this weekend.
